WebExample 1: Given x 2 + 5x + 6 = 0. ( x + 3) ( x + 2) = 0 (factoring the polynomial) ( x + 3) = 0 OR ( x + 2) = 0. Thus x = −3, Or x = −2. The example above shows that it is indeed easy to solve quadratics by factoring method. However, the method only works for the most basic equations.
